The media shows a page from a textbook discussing methods for measuring irregular shapes, specifically using the square and strip methods. The page features diagrams illustrating these techniques. One diagram, labeled Fig. 23.6(b), shows an irregular shape divided into numbered squares, with some squares being complete and others incomplete. Another diagram, Fig. 23.7, depicts an irregular shape overlaid with parallel vertical strips.

The text provides detailed instructions and examples for calculating the area of these irregular shapes. It outlines the steps for the square method, which involves counting complete and incomplete squares and using a scale to determine the actual area. Similarly, the strip method is explained, involving dividing the shape into strips of equal width and calculating the total length of these strips. The text also includes calculations and results for sample problems, such as an actual area of 4.5 km².

Towards the bottom of the page, a new section titled "23.7 MEASUREMENT OF DIRECTION AND BEARING" begins. This section introduces the concept of direction and cardinal points (North, South, East, West) and mentions eight and sixteen cardinal points for more accurate measurements.
